X-RAY DIFFRACTION

Crystallization Details
Method pH Temprature Details
X-RAY DIFFRACTION 8.5 298 0.2M sodium acetate, 0.1M Tris, 30% w/v PEG 4000, NADH (10mM), L-Threonine (30mM)
Unit Cell:
a: 83.450 Å b: 136.120 Å c: 55.690 Å α: 90.000° β: 90.000° γ: 90.000°
Symmetry:
Space Group: P 21 21 2
Crystal Properties:
Matthew's Coefficient: 2.09 Solvent Content: 41.24
Refinement Statistics
Diffraction ID Structure Solution Method Cross Validation Method Resolution Limit (High) Resolution Limit (Low) Number of Reflections (Observed) Number of Reflections (R-free) Percent Reflections (Observed) R-Work R-Free Mean Isotropic
X-RAY DIFFRACTION MOLECULAR REPLACEMENT THROUGHOUT 1.7200 43.1400 64406 3443 99.4500 0.1545 0.1976 27.6670
